    We have a use case where-in CC agent need to see the customer conversation transcript once call will be forwarded to genesys by audiocodes<o:p></o:p>

    As customer ßà voicebot transcript is stored at our company Azure BLOB storage<o:p></o:p>

    What I expect:<o:p></o:p>

    1. Genesys will extract the conversationID from the SIP header and call the company API to retrieve the transcript by conversation ID.
    2. There will be minimum orchestration at genesys to call the API

    Please let us know how we can achieve this in genesys or there can be any alternate/simplified solution.

    For point 1, if call arriving on a sip trunk into Genesys, which will be configured in the Admin Trunk section, you can edit the external trunk and enable "User to User Information" (UUI)

    You set the sip header name, encoding and protocol discriminator. e.g.

    Genesys will do its thing and the extracted value will be available in Architect flow in the system variable Call.UUIData
